Multiple reviews report that the site is a scam used to phish personal information through fake job postings. Users describe the interface as poor and warn that the emails and job alerts are spam. Many report being unable to unsubscribe or remove their information. Several reviews mention connections to suspicious other sites and companies. Only one review reports a positive experience with membership access issues.
